Mid price range Intel-based PC for 2k gaming [BUILD/SUGGESTIONS/QUESTION]

Hey guys! So I'm planning on building my first gaming / multimedia / music production PC this month and I wanted to hear your feedback on my spec choices. 

Also, I have one question that really keeping me up at night: Is it worth it picking up RTX 2060 S for 480 usd when I can get new GTX 1080 for 370 usd? (I don't care that much about RTX technology as it is, especially knowing that 2060s wouldn't be powerfull enough to run games with it in 2k anyways). 

Here are parts I've chosen and approx. price on them (converted from local currency):

  • Intel Core i5 9600KF $210
  • Noctua NH-U12S chromax.black $85
  • MSI MPG Z390 Gaming Plus $140
  • G.Skill DDR4-3000 Ripjaws V Red 16GB $80
  • !!! MSI GeForce RTX 2060 Super Gaming X $480 OR MSI GeForce GTX 1080 GAMING X 8G $370 !!!
  • PATRIOT Viper VPN100 512 GB $90
  • Toshiba P300 2TB $55
  • be quiet! Straight Power 11 550W $115
  • NZXT H510 Matte Black-Red $90

Total Build Price: $1,345 / $1,235

 

+

  • Monitor: 31.5" LG UltraGear 32GK650F-B $370 (if anyone wondering)

4 minutes ago, Deathwish-OwO said:

this one for good amount of years to come

And thats where it turns. AMD has great support for future chips. Intel does not, and will be leaving their current platform this year. So if you end up going with that 9600- you're stuck on that chipset and won't be able to upgrade.
